Failure is an unavoidable part of the investment process. If after each failure you only blame the market without reflecting on yourself, you will repeat the same old mistakes. What is important is:

Learn from failure: Thoroughly analyze your own decisions, identify the real causes (capital management, psychology, strategy…) and draw lessons.

Take responsibility: Don’t blame the market; recognize that most mistakes stem from how you trade.

Adjust strategies: After each failure, improve the process, trading discipline, and update knowledge to avoid repeating mistakes.

Persevere and grow: Success comes from continuously learning and adapting to the market.

Stop blaming the market; take responsibility, learn from mistakes, and improve to move forward.
